预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于SVG显示模型的WebGIS的设计与研究 随着互联网技术的不断发展,WebGIS已成为了地理信息科学中一个不可或缺的组成部分,其准确定位和可视化表示地理空间信息的能力越来越受到人们的重视。而此类应用化WebGIS也在渗透到许多的领域,包括工业、农业、交通、电力、环境保护等多个领域。随着网络技术的不断进步,WebGIS的可存储、可交换、可显示、可处理等性能也不断提升。 基于SVG(ScalableVectorGraphics)显示模型的WebGIS也在这一领域中卓越发挥着自己的优势,SVG是一种标准的可缩放矢量图形语言,它是一种基于XML语法的图形格式。相对于其他图像格式,SVG文件占用更小的空间,具有更高的清晰度,并且它可以被高效地压缩,也易于进行网络传输。因此,SVG是WebGIS开发的理想标准。 在WebGIS中,SVG的第一种应用主要是用来制作静态矢量图,但是它的能力还能扩展到交互式地理信息展示,如动画效果等。SVG的独特之处在于它能够通过JavaScript和HTMLDOM来与Web文档和CSS相互作用,使得大量的用户特定效果成为可能。由于互动性的自然属性,该技术提供了一个开放平台,可以不断发展。它也可以用来构建更加高级的WebGIS应用程序,比如地图搜索与高级可视化分析等。 在WebGIS中,SVG可以采用多种方式。 一种是将SVG图形嵌入到HTML页面中,能够在网页中占据矩形形状,也可以调整大小、填充和边框等属性。 第二种是将SVG图形拆分成单独的文件来引用,这种方式从结构和逻辑上更加清晰,同时也使得对SVG图形进行修改或更新更加方便。 第三种是将SVG用作矢量地图数据的存储格式,可用于进行更加复杂的GIS分析和建模操作。 使用SVG技术,我们可以创建具有交互性和丰富的功能的WebGIS应用程序。在GIS环境中,SVG技术发挥着越来越多的作用,在实现地理信息分析和可视化方面的表现也越来越好。 除此之外,SVG技术还具有以下优点:首先,SVG图形可以与现成的组件、模板和代码库进行交互。其次,在标准的浏览器和操作系统上,SVG图形都是可以显示的。再次,在浏览器和操作系统之间,它们的显示也是一致的。最后,SVG语言是开放的标准并且简单易于使用。 综上所述,基于SVG显示模型的WebGIS是一个十分有前途的发展方向。无论是在GIS应用开发还是Web应用开发中,SVG技术都可以为我们提供更加高效、优质、方便的数据交互环境。极大地提升了WebGIS的可视化展示的表现力。